We are seeking experienced 3.5T (Van) and 7.5T Drivers for multi-drop work out of Morley, Leeds. The role will involve the delivery of White Goods to customers in the Yorkshire Region. You must be physically fit for this role and be flexible on start and finish times due to delivery slots.

You must have a full UK Drivers Licence, have the right to work in the UK, and be able to pass a standard DBS check. You should have a maximum of 6 points on your licence (NO DR or IN Codes).

Job Summary:
  • Multi-drop
  • Deliver and unbox in the room of the customer's choice
  • Working a 10.5 hour day
  • Paperwork and removal of packaging for return to the depot for recycling

There is the potential for long-term temporary work on this contract.
